OnePlus 7 and 7 Pro OxygenOS 10.0 Changelog

  • System
    • Upgraded to Android 10
    • The brand new UI design
    • Enhanced location permissions for privacy
    • New customization feature in Settings allowing you to choose icon shapes to be displayed in the Quick Settings
  • Full-Screen Gestures
    • Added inward swipes from the left or right edge of the screen to go back
    • Added a bottom navigation bar to allow switching left or right for recent apps
  • Game Space
    • New Game Space feature now joins all your favorite games in one place for easier access and better gaming experience
  • Smart display
    • Intelligent info based on specific times, locations and events for Ambient Display (Settings – Display – Ambient Display – Smart Display)
  • Message
    • Now possible to block spam by keywords for Message (Messages – Spam – Settings – Blocking settings)

Check For OxygenOS 10.0 OTA Update

If you’re using OnePlus 7 or OnePlus 7 Pro phone and don’t want to wait for long, you can manually check for the update. Go To Settings > System Updates > Check for update. It will take a few weeks to reach all corners of the world. Direct method

This method allows you to install the downloaded update directly from your OnePlus 7 and 7 Pro. The steps to do this are:

  • Save the downloaded update file into the internal memory of your OnePlus 7 and 7 Pro
  • Open settings
  • Tap on system updates
  • Tap on the settings icon
  • Select local upgrade
  • Select the saved OTA update file
  • When prompted select upgrade now option
